?? 設(shè)計文檔.txt
字號:
城市公交線路應(yīng)用開發(fā)
概 述:
主要內(nèi)容:
公交線路信息管理系統(tǒng)包括公交線路信息定義、公交線路信息綜合應(yīng)用、公交線路站牌管理三個部分。
A.查詢方法簡單、多樣:
1.針對不同分類的信息,可以根據(jù)不同條件(如:名稱、等級、類別等)進行不同的模糊查詢,
并且支持多角度、多條件的組合查詢,查詢方法簡單、快捷、明了。
2.系統(tǒng)提供相應(yīng)的查詢操作,管理員可以進行公交線路各類信息的定義、增加、修改和刪除,而
查詢者只提供查詢,從而保證了系統(tǒng)數(shù)據(jù)的安全性。
B.主要功能:
1.對站點信息的查詢及顯示控制
可以對站點進行模糊查詢、列表查詢、地圖查詢,其中模糊查詢又可以對站點按名稱、等級、
所在道路進行查詢。同時可以控制站點及其名稱是否顯示。
2.對線路信息的查詢及顯示控制
可以對線路進行輸入查詢和列表查詢,并且具有查詢過站點所有線路的功能。同時可以控制線
路上、下行的顯示,或者在地圖中顯示線路,并且可以選擇任意不同的線路組合進行顯示。
3.最優(yōu)路線的查詢及顯示控制 可以對線路進行最優(yōu)路線查詢,并且在地圖中顯示線路。
設(shè)計擬將解決的問題
1、統(tǒng)一管理站點、線路、道路、站牌等各類公交線路信息,有效的利用公交線路各類信息,整合資源,
實現(xiàn)資源共享,保證信息管理的高效、準確、及時。
2、公交線路信息綜合應(yīng)用的強大出圖功能,可以根據(jù)需要出各種不同的線路效果圖,在線路效果圖中
可以自由控制站點、信息點、線路、道路的顯示,顯示經(jīng)過站點的所有線路,顯示線路站點或顯示任意
所選線路等,并對上述顯示控制進行任意不同的組合。
運行環(huán)境:
操作系統(tǒng):
Windows 2000 Professional,Windows 2000 Server ,Windows 2000 Advanced Server
硬件要求:
1、 CPU: Intel Pentium II-class 300 MHz (最好Intel Pentium III-class 600 MHz)
2、 內(nèi)存:
3、 顯示: 800x600, 256 colors
開發(fā)工具:
Microsoft Visual Basic 6.0 簡體中文版
界面設(shè)計:
功能定義:
1.公交線路數(shù)據(jù)的管理
<1>定義
<2>操作(包括對數(shù)據(jù)的增加、修改和刪除)
2.公交線路的查詢(包括精確查詢和模糊查詢)
<1>站點信息的查詢及顯示(要求輸入站點名稱)
<2>公交線路的查詢及顯示(要求輸入公交線路名稱)
3.最優(yōu)線路的查詢(要求輸入始點和終點)
模塊劃分:
1.公交線路各類信息的管理模塊
<1>線路定義模塊
<2>線路數(shù)據(jù)的操作模塊
2.公交線路的查詢模塊
<1>精確查詢模塊
<2>模糊查詢模塊
數(shù)據(jù)流圖:
數(shù)據(jù)庫設(shè)計:
字 段 數(shù)據(jù)類型 字段大小(字符) 說 明
1.Bus表:
(主鍵) BusName 文本 50 公交線路名稱
FirstSite 文本 50 公交起點名稱
FirstSiteX 數(shù)字 雙精度 公交起點的X軸坐標
FirstSiteY 數(shù)字 雙精度 公交起點的Y軸坐標
LastSite 文本 50 公交終點名稱
LastSiteX 數(shù)字 雙精度 公交終點的X軸坐標
LastSiteY 數(shù)字 雙精度 公交終點的Y軸坐標
2.BusLine表:
BusLine 文本 50 公交線路名稱
PassSiteX 數(shù)字 雙精度 公交經(jīng)點的X軸坐標
PassSiteY 數(shù)字 雙精度 公交經(jīng)點的Y軸坐標
3.SiteName表:
(主鍵) BusName 文本 50 公交線路名稱
SiteName 文本 50 公交站點名稱
SiteX 數(shù)字 雙精度 公交站點的X軸坐標
SiteY 數(shù)字 雙精度 公交站點的Y軸坐標
4.Users表:
(主鍵) UserID 數(shù)字 自動編號 用戶ID
UserName 文本 50 用戶名
Userpassword 文本 50 用戶密碼
?? 快捷鍵說明
復(fù)制代碼
Ctrl + C
搜索代碼
Ctrl + F
全屏模式
F11
切換主題
Ctrl + Shift + D
顯示快捷鍵
?
增大字號
Ctrl + =
減小字號
Ctrl + -